Regional Connectivity: A “Push” for Southern Industrial Real Estate

A series of infrastructure projects, including the expanded National Route 13, Ring Road 3, Long Thanh Airport, Long Thanh – Dau Giay Expressway, and National Route 1, are expected to significantly boost industrial real estate development in Southern Vietnam.

Roads Paving the Way for Southern Industrial Parks

Amidst the global supply chain shifts, regional connectivity is becoming a strategic driving force in the race to attract investment into Southern industrial real estate. More than just improving traffic, the current strategic infrastructure system is reshaping the entire region’s logistics and industrial development landscape.

Specifically, the expanded National Route 13 enhances cargo transport capacity from Ho Chi Minh City to Binh Duong and Binh Phuoc – areas with numerous large industrial parks. This not only alleviates congestion but also expands the operational reach for existing and future factories and warehouses.

Ho Chi Minh City’s Ring Road 3, a national key infrastructure project, connects Dong Nai – Long An – Binh Duong – Ho Chi Minh City, forming a continuous supply chain. This helps save 25-30% on transportation time, reduces logistics costs, and enhances the competitiveness of industrial enterprises.

The HCMC – Long Thanh – Dau Giay Expressway and Long Thanh International Airport are two pivotal infrastructure components that facilitate easy access for Southern industrial goods to international markets. Meanwhile, National Route 1 continues to serve as the backbone, a vital transportation artery of Vietnam, connecting from North to South. It plays a crucial role in goods transport, linking industrial parks, seaports, and border gates, as well as promoting economic and social exchange between regions.

Southern industrial parks are accelerating investment attraction thanks to an increasingly complete inter-regional transportation infrastructure network.

Beyond air and road networks, Southern industrial parks are also strongly bolstered by modern international seaport systems like Cai Mep – Thi Vai and Cat Lai – Vietnam’s leading import-export gateways. Thanks to their strategic locations near major logistics routes, industrial parks directly connected to these ports can optimize transportation costs and shorten delivery times, especially for export shipments to the US, Europe, and Northeast Asia.

It’s precisely this synchronized and strategic development of inter-regional infrastructure that is driving increased demand for factory rentals in Southern industrial real estate, particularly in well-planned industrial parks near key connection routes. This forms the foundation for the region to break through, attract high-quality FDI, and move towards green and sustainable industrial development.

TRENDS IN NEW GENERATION INDUSTRIAL PARK INVESTMENT

In the context of production globalization and supply chain shifts, Vietnam – especially the Southern industrial park region – is witnessing the strong emergence of new-generation industrial parks. No longer just places to build factories, Southern industrial real estate is gradually being redefined with multi-layered integrated models, simultaneously meeting demands for technology, environment, and quality of life.

Green and sustainable development is becoming the standard in the wave of industrial park investment in the South.

New-generation industrial parks are now planned with digital infrastructure such as 5G networks, IoT platforms, smart energy management systems, along with dedicated spaces for R&D centers and clusters of supporting businesses. This model not only boosts production efficiency but also shortens operational time and improves flexibility – factors highly valued by FDI enterprises.

Furthermore, industrial park investment trends show significant interest in comprehensive ecosystems: worker housing areas, integrated logistics services, transparent legal systems, and convenient inter-regional connectivity. All these create a robust growth picture, where new-generation industrial parks are not just production sites but also nuclei for sustainable socio-economic development in the future.

Crucially, sustainability is becoming a mandatory criterion. According to government orientation, by 2030, at least 30% of industrial parks must meet green/LEED standards. This means developers must integrate smart wastewater treatment systems, optimize energy efficiency, and build environmentally friendly infrastructure.
